On Sun, 2003-12-21 at 10:07, mike wrote: > On Sun, 2003-12-21 at 15:54, Donald Henson wrote: > > I'm posting to two lists because I'm not sure where the problem resides. > > > > (SuSe Linux 9.0 Pro, Gnome 2.2.2, Nautilus 2.2.4) > > > > Early in my newbie days, I created a desktop launcher that opened my > > home directory in Nautilus. I recently installed a beta version of > > AbiWord (2.1.0). Afterwards, whenever I clicked on the icon, AbiWord > > opened instead of a Nautilus window. I tried various methods to correct > > this but eventually gave up and created a new launcher. I then attempted > > to delete the old launcher but I can't get the "Move to Trash" menu item > > to become active. It's grayed out. When I click on the rogue icon, I get > > an error message, "The Media view encountered an error while starting > > up." (If anyone has any thoughts on the above, I'd appreciate hearing > > them but that's not the question.) My real question is how can I get rid > > of this launcher? I figure that root can do it but I'm not sure where to > > look or what to delete. Any assistance will be appreciated. > > > > Don Henson > > > > > > first you need to find out the name of the launcher > > do ls -l .gnome-desktop (or I think .gnome2/desktop/launchers from > memory) > > find the the right file, then rm it > That worked.
